
W.l Weller 12 Years
Overview
W.L. Weller 12 Years is a celebrated wheated bourbon from Buffalo Trace Distillery, often referred to as "poor man's Pappy." This bourbon combines a storied legacy with a smooth profile, appealing to both novices and connoisseurs alike.
Specs at a glance
| Detail | Info |
|---|---|
| Style | Wheated bourbon |
| ABV | 45% (90 proof) |
| Mashbill | Wheat-based (exact mashbill undisclosed) |
| Release Info | Aged 12 years, with a history of being accessible but now often scarce due to demand for premium relatives like Pappy Van Winkle. MSRP was historically around $20-30 but has escalated in secondary markets. |
| Age | 12 years |
Good to know
Originally crafted by William Larue Weller in 1825, this bourbon has evolved into a benchmark for wheated styles. Its connection to Pappy Van Winkle has spurred a fervent collector interest. Once widely available, it is now a rare find, driving prices significantly higher than its original retail.
Tasting notes
- Nose: Cherry preserves, caramel, vanilla, and a hint of clove greet you, layered with oak and ginger.
- Palate: Smooth and inviting, flavors of toffee, baked cherry pie, and rich caramel come through with a touch of black pepper and mint.
- Finish: A warm, nutty finish with lingering baking spices and a refreshing mint oak essence.
Notable details
- Production: Matured in standard barrels at Buffalo Trace, characterized by its wheated recipe, this bourbon is known for its approachable flavor profile.
- Lineage: Part of a lineage that includes some of the finest wheated bourbons, its similarities to Pappy Van Winkle have led to its nickname as "baby Pappy."
- Comparison: Often compared to other wheated bourbons like Larceny and Maker's Mark, it stands out due to its complexity and age.
- Availability: Once a shelf staple, now hard to find, with current secondary market prices averaging $59, often exceeding $89.
